Fair Prey


"Fair Prey", a brief narrative crafted by Daniel Wallace, saw its release within the pages of Star Wars Gamer 1 back in 2000, courtesy of Wizards of the Coast. Functioning as a follow-up to Wallace's prior work, The Great Herdship Heist, it had initially received the green light for inclusion in issue 18 of the Star Wars Adventure Journal, a publication that ultimately never materialized.

Plot summary

The narrative unfolds as Cecil Noone attempts to sell a pilfered Hapan Gun of Command on the obscure world of Kabal. However, the situation dramatically reverses when the celebrated hunter Tyro Viveca intervenes. Consequently, Cecil finds himself in a frantic struggle for survival, racing against the clock, advanced technology, and the planet's hostile conditions, all to evade Viveca's relentless pursuit on his opulent property.
